  • This Civic was hit in the side by another vehicle. Since the roof was buckled in multiple locations and the skin needed to be replaced to avoid excessive amounts of filler. I used a roof skin with a sunroof, and added the wiring, sunroof assembly, switch, drain tubes and head liner from another car with a sunroof.

    • @vehcor
      @vehcor  5 ปีที่แล้ว +1

      I have done a few factory sunroof installs. When you know what is needed, it is not too bad. People do not realize the amount of work, it is not like the aftermarket, cut a hole and connect some wires. A lot of that work overlapped with repairing the collision damage on this one.     @tanveerkhan9221 6 ปีที่แล้ว +1

    Looks absolutely brilliant is the car structurally the same as it left the factory would it handle another side impact

    • @vehcor
      @vehcor  6 ปีที่แล้ว +4

      Thanks, yes, it will take the next crash the exact same way as the first. All the pieces were put in in the factory locations with the exception of the outer panel which is not structural and can be sectioned in, just about anywhere. If it were all just straightened and painted, the answer would be "no, it will not be the same". That is the difference between a proper repair and improper repair. Thanks for watching.
